1. Location

The famous phrase “location, location, location” will always hold true. The location of a property is perhaps the most critical factor to consider during your house hunting journey. Location can have a large impact on the overall quality of life you’ll experience – especially if it affects your daily commute. During your process, be sure to research neighborhood safety and school ratings. Also, keep in mind your proximity to amenities like grocery stores, restaurants, and parks.

2. Affordability

Determine your budget early in your process and stick to it. Measure your finances carefully – consider not only the listed price of a home but additional costs such as closing fees, property taxes, and homeowner’s insurance. Sticking to the budget you’ve calculated will help ensure your financial stability and overall happiness in your new home.

3. Property Condition

Be sure to inspect the condition of a property, both indoors and outdoors. Keep an eye out for signs of wear and tear or structural issues that would require repairs. The overall structural integrity of a home is a key factor to consider. Prior to closing on any property in your home buyer journey, hire a professional inspector to uncover potentially hidden issues such as water damage, mold, or pest infestations.

4. Layout and Size

Evaluate your current and future needs for bedrooms and bathrooms in a home, taking into account its layout and how well it aligns with your preferences. Remember, the flow of living spaces is about more than just square footage – it influences daily comfort and functionality. Make sure the home’s size and layout can comfortably accommodate you and your family.

5. Outdoor Space

During your house hunt, assess the outdoor areas of each property with a keen eye not just on their size, but also their function. From extensive yards to cozy balconies, different homes can offer varying options for recreation and entertainment. Consider your lifestyle and preferences to determine if the outdoor area aligns with your needs and if there’s potential for future projects.

6. Home Technology

In today’s age, technology plays a significant role in our everyday lives. During your house hunting journey, check the reliability of the internet connections, network coverage, and other essential utilities at each property. Determine whether the home is equipped with modern amenities such as smart home systems, energy-efficient appliances, and home security features.

7. Potential Resale Value

While it’s most important to find a home that meets your immediate needs, it is also worth considering its long-term value and potential as an investment. Prior to closing on a property, research home value trends in the area and assess factors that could affect the property’s future value. Choose a home that not only meets your living requirements but also holds promise for future returns.

8. Your Gut Feeling

Last but not least – trust your initial gut feeling for each home. Pay attention to how you feel when you step inside. Do you envision yourself living there as you view its living spaces? While it’s most important to be rational in your decision-making process, don’t underestimate the power of intuition when finding your dream home.
